12. d unplug the power cord Clean and dry the interior thoroughly To prevent odor and mold growth leave the door open slightly blocking it open if necessary or have the door removed Moving Your Freezer 9 PERL TB SQ ange Sage Remove all the food Securely tape down all loose items inside your freezer Remove the rollers to prevent damage Tape the doors shut Be sure the freezer stays in the upright position during transportation Energy Saving Tips 2 The freezer should be located in the coolest area of the room away from heat producing appliances or heating ducts and out of the direct sunlight Let hot foods cool to room temperature before placing in the freezer Overloading the freezer forces the compressor to run longer Foods that freeze too slowly may lose quality or spoil Be sure to wrap foods properly and wipe containers dry before placing them in the freezer This cuts down on frost build up inside the freezer Freezer storage bin should not be lined with aluminum foil wax paper or paper toweling Liners interfere with cold air circulation making the freezer less efficient Organize and label food to reduce door openings and extended searches Remove as many items as needed at one time and close the door as soon as possible 11 PROBLEMS WITH YOUR FREEZER You can solve many common freezer problems easily saving you the cost of a possible service call Try the suggestions below to see if you can solve the

19. problem before calling the servicer T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E PROBLEM POSSIBLE CAUSE Freezer does not operate Not plugged in The circuit breaker tripped or a blown fuse The freezer temperature control is set at OFF Compressor turns on and off frequently The room temperature is hotterthan normal A large amount of food has been added to the freezer The door is opened too often The door is not closed completely The temperature control is not set correctly The door gasket does not seal properly The freezer does not have the correct clearances The freezer has recently been disconnected for a period of time Four hours are required for the freezer to cool down completely Temperature inside the freezer is too warm Temperature control is set too warm Turn the control to a cooler setting and allow several hours for the temperature to stabilize Door is kept open too long or is opened too frequently Warm air enters the freezer every time the door is opened Open the door less often The door is not closed completely The door gasket does not seal properly A large amount of warm or hot food might have been stored recently Wait until the freezer has had a chance to reach its selected temperature The freezer has recently been disconnected for a period of time Four hours are required for the freezer to cool down completely Temperature inside the freezer is too cold Temperature control is set too cold Turn the cont
20. rol to a warmer setting and allow several hours for the temperature to stabilize Temperature of external freezer surface is warm The exterior freezer walls can be as much as 30 F warmer than room temperature This is normal while the compressor works to transfer heat from inside the freezer cabinet Popping or cracking sound when compressor Metal parts undergo expansion and contraction comes on as in hot water pipes This is normal Sound will level off or disappear as freezer continues to run Refrigerant used to cool freezer is circulating throughout the system This is normal Vibrations Check to assure that the freezer is on a level surface Floor is uneven or weak Freezer rocks on the 12 floor when it is moved slightly Be sure floor can adequately support freezer Level the freezer by putting wood or metal shims under part of the freezer The freezer is touching the wall Re level the freezer and move it from the wall See Installation Instructions Moisture forms on inside freezer walls Weather is hot and humid which increases internal rate of frost build up This is normal Door is slightly open Door is kept open too long or is opened too frequently Open the door less often The door is not sealed properly Moisture forms on outside of freezer Door is slightly open causing cold air from inside the freezer to meet warm moist air from outside The door will not close properly The freezer is not on

24. ure to defrost when the ice reaches to Y inch thick A storage basket is provided for the organization of odd shaped items To reach other packages in the freezer just slide the basket to one side or lift it out CARE AND MAINTENANCE Cleaning Your Freezer Upon installation of your new appliance it is recommended that it be cleaned thoroughly Turn the temperature control to OFF unplug the freezer remove the food and storage basket Wash the inside with a damp warm cloth containing a water and baking soda solution The solution should be about 2 tablespoons of baking soda to a quart of water Wash the storage basket with a mild detergent solution Be sure to keep the door gasket seal clean to keep the unit running efficiently The outside of the freezer should be cleaned with mild detergent and warm water Dry the interior and exterior with a soft cloth 10 It is recommended that the unit be cleaned each time it is defrosted to help keep the unit odor free and running efficiently Vacation Time Remove all the food Unplug the freezer Clean the freezer Leave the door open slightly to avoid possible formation of condensation mold or odors Use extreme caution in the case of children The unit should not be accessible to child s play Short vacations Leave the freezer operating during vacations of less than three weeks Long vacations If the appliance will not be used for several months remove all food an
